CARE Caucasus is a non-governmental organization with the mission to decrease social injustice, vulnerability, and poverty, and contribute to improved conditions for sustainable development and security in the South Caucasus region.

ABOUT THE ROLE:

The Board of CARE Caucasus is seeking to appoint an outstanding, experienced Chief Executive Officer (CEO) to lead the organization into a future of growth, resilience and innovation.
CARE Caucasus CEO is the highest-ranking executive in the organization. S/he leads CARE`s strategy and operations in the South Caucasus towards CARE`s vision and drives for impact.

The CEO is responsible for overseeing the development, funding and implementation of the CARE Caucasus strategy and a program portfolio that effectively addresses the underlying causes of poverty in line with CARE`s vision. S/he must also ensure that systems are in place and being properly implemented that ensure the proper management, well-being and safety of CARE staff and the proper stewardship of CARE resources. The CEO is responsible for ensuring an organizational culture where CARE core values - Respect, Integrity, Commitment and Excellence - are practiced, team work is encouraged and all staff feel valued. S/he is responsible for establishing and maintaining good working relationships with host government officials, donors and other partners.

Main responsibilities:

REPRESENTATION OF CARE CAUCASUS - Represent the organization before all stakeholders; report to the supervisory board and act as the main point of communication between the board and the management as well as the key connector with CARE International (CI).

STRATEGIC AND OPERATIONAL PLANNING - Lead the design, implementation and evolution of the CARE Caucasus strategic plan as relevant to the country and regional context, and in line with the CARE International vision and mission.

PROGRAM IMPACT AND RELEVANCE - Oversee CARE Caucasus programming to advance CARE`s vision and mission, in line with CARE`s standards for program quality. Work in partnerships with others inside and outside of CARE to achieve broad scale impact. Ensure engagement and contribution of program participants in CARE Caucasus program design and monitoring. Make every effort to promote, create and maintain a safe organizational culture for all people who work for and with CARE, including our partners and the communities where CARE works.
FINANCIAL MANAGEMENT, RESOURCE MOBILIZATION & OPERATIONS VIABILITY - Direct the mobilization, management and accounting of all resources in CARE Caucasus in compliance with applicable laws, CARE policies and donor requirements.

HUMAN RESOURCES - Build a strong, innovative senior leadership team and effectively manage all direct reports and the organization.

qualifications:

Education & technical skills:

** Master`s degree in development studies, social sciences, economics, human rights, business administration or in other relevant discipline;
** Fluent written and spoken English and Georgian. The knowledge of any other language used in the South Caucasus will be an asset;
** Strong digital acumen; ability to lead tech-driven initiatives.

Experience:

Required:

** Minimum ten years of experience in international development or humanitarian assistance;
** Minimum five years of experience at the senior management level, preferably in Caucasus or in countries vulnerable to multiple natural hazards / disasters;
** Experience in leading multi-disciplinary and multi-national teams;
** Experience in development, review and implementation of strategic plans;
** Experience in fundraising, resource mobilization and donor relations;
** Experience in managing security, risk and legal compliance, preferably within an INGO or regional organization context
** Solid understanding of financial and budget management and of best practice programming (expertise by sector would be an asset);
** Proven abilities in decision-making and problem-solving including in emergency contexts.

Desired:

** Past experience managing NGO or private sector organization at an executive level;
** Experience in engaging private sector and managing large scale fundraising activities;
** Knowledge of key social & development issues, government and donor networks in Georgia and Caucasus region.

Key competencies:

** Ability to work independently and within a team, ability to handle detail concurrent with strategic issues, creativity, efficiency, organizational skills and reverence of deadlines and time obligations.
** Excellent managerial, analytical, interpersonal, communication, negotiating and team building skills.
** Ability to anticipate and mitigate risks that could threaten the organization`s reputation, operational viability and/or security.

Location:

This position is based in Tbilisi and requires local, regional and international travel.
